Artifact signing for LiftPath, our elevator-dispatch simulator. Every simulator build published to the Skyrail registry must carry a detached signature; unsigned builds are rejected at ingest. The release manager signs the tarball after the scenario regression suite passes. Signing happens on the isolated build host using the key below.

deploy key for kahof-tadup: bky4_rRMZ

## Incremental Rebuilds (Slatepress)

On content change, the builder rebuilds only affected pages via the dependency graph. If the graph is stale, output drifts — symptoms: missing nav updates, old prices. Fix: trigger a graph refresh, then requeue the failed paths. Full rebuild is last resort; it takes ~40 minutes and blocks the queue. Check the rebuild dashboard before and after. Builder runs with the following values:

service settings:
PRAIX_LOG_LEVEL=error
PRAIX_METRICS_HOST=metrics.praix.qorvelcorp.corp
PRAIX_POOL_SIZE=16

- [ ] **Step 7: Breaker override escrow.** After sealing the signing keys for the Tallgrove upstream API circuit breaker, confirm the support team can force the breaker open during a full outage. The override bundle lives in the sealed escrow drawer and is useless without its unlock phrase. Two ceremony witnesses must initial this step before proceeding. The escrow bundle is decrypted with the recovery passphrase that follows.

vault phrase of kahip-kahop = holath-quenmir

Subject: Parcel webhook cut-over done

Plugin authors — the Cartoline tracking webhook moved to the v2 dispatcher last night. Old endpoint returns 410 as of today; update your receivers now. Payload shape is unchanged except the status enum, which gained two values — handle unknowns gracefully. Retries are now exponential with a 24-hour cap. Signature scheme is unchanged. The dispatcher settings you should validate against are below.

settings of tagef-bawif:
DRUIX_HOST=druix.zemvarlabs.internal
DRUIX_PORT=8000